Umbilical: The belly button is a very common place for hernias to occur given that it was a natural opening in utero (that is, the umbilical ring) for the umbilical vessels to pass from the mother into the fetus. This opening closes spontaneously over time, but can be a weak point that allows hernias to occur. Laparoscopy is another name for "keyhole" surgery or "minimally invasive" diagnostic medical procedure used to check or to operate on the internal organs or tissues inside your belly (abdomen) or pelvic cavities.
